What is an Rj45 Ethernet Cable Wiring Diagram and How is it Used?

An Rj45 Ethernet Cable Wiring Diagram is a visual representation that details the specific pinout configuration for connecting the individual wires inside an Ethernet cable to the pins of an RJ45 connector. The RJ45 connector is the standard plug used for Ethernet cables, allowing them to interface with network devices like computers, routers, and switches. The diagram shows the order in which the colored wires should be terminated at each of the eight pins on the connector. This order is not arbitrary; it follows specific industry standards to ensure that data signals travel correctly between devices.

These diagrams are essential for creating or repairing Ethernet cables. When you crimp an RJ45 connector onto an Ethernet cable, you need to strip the outer jacket, untwist the pairs of wires, and then arrange them in the correct sequence before inserting them into the connector and crimping it down. There are two main wiring standards commonly depicted in an Rj45 Ethernet Cable Wiring Diagram: T568A and T568B. While both standards use the same eight wires, they differ in the arrangement of two of the wire pairs. The importance of adhering to these standards cannot be overstated, as incorrect wiring will lead to a non-functional network connection or, at best, unreliable performance.

Network technicians and enthusiasts rely on the Rj45 Ethernet Cable Wiring Diagram to:

  1. Create straight-through cables (used to connect dissimilar devices, like a computer to a router).
  2. Create crossover cables (historically used to connect similar devices, like two computers directly, though modern network hardware often handles this automatically).
  3. Troubleshoot existing cable issues.
